The Weight of Faith: Unpacking the Meaning of Covenant by Soen
As I first heard the song "Covenant" by Soen, I was struck by the haunting lyrics that seemed to grasp at the very foundations of human nature. The song delves into the complexities of faith, morality, and spirituality, forcing listeners to confront the intricate web of emotions and temptations that we all experience. As I delved deeper into the meaning behind these words, I found myself drawn into a world of introspection and self-reflection, where the true nature of our existence began to unfold.
Loss and Uncertainty
The song’s opening lines "He’s walking down the aisle, led by another hand" sent a shiver down my spine. It’s a poignant depiction of a person walking into the unknown, surrendering to the desires and expectations of others without a sense of direction. This theme of loss and uncertainty is a powerful reflection of our own experiences of being swept up in the currents of life, carried by forces beyond our control. It’s a harrowing realization that we can become trapped in a state of emotional limbo, unable to break free from the constraints of our fears and doubts.
The Struggle with Shame and Pride
As the song progresses, the lyrics shift to a poignant exploration of shame and pride. The line "Shame and pride, they go hand in hand" struck a chord within me. How often do we find ourselves torn between our desire for acceptance and recognition, only to be ensnared by the cruel trap of our own inflated egos? The words "leave the shadows behind" echoed through my mind, serving as a timely reminder to shed the mantle of our insecurities and fears, and instead embracing the raw, unvarnished truth of who we are.
Redemption and Personal Freedom
The chorus, with its "hallowed ground" and "punishment for the sins", is a chilling reminder of the consequences that await us when we ignore the warnings of our inner voices. Yet, there is a glimmer of hope amidst this darkness. The bridge of the song delivers a message of personal freedom, suggesting that true emancipation comes from within. "Break the chain, don’t be defined", the lyrics seem to say, as they urge us to shatter the shackles of self-doubt and follow our hearts. It’s a liberating concept that echoes throughout the song: our salvation lies not in external authorities or institutions, but in our own choices and willpower.
The Poisons of Desire
And yet, we are human, and with our vulnerabilities comes the specter of lust and temptation. "Human nature, poison the soul", the song warns us, reminding us that the line between desire and desecration is perilously thin. It’s a cruel truth, but one that we cannot ignore. "Desire is blind, don’t be mislead", the song seems to caution, imploring us to remain aware of our own desires, lest they consume us whole.
A Cautionary Tale
The song’s ending, with its repetition of the phrase "Sinner will face punishment", is a haunting warning against the dangers of indulging in our baser instincts. It’s a stark reminder that our actions have consequences, and that we cannot escape the reaping of what we’ve sown. "He who walks the narrow path will find the answers", the song seems to suggest, as it leaves us with a sense of unease and trepidation. Will we take the warning to heart, or will we succumb to the allure of our vices? The choice, as the song so keenly highlights, is ultimately ours alone.
Reflections
As I’ve come to understand the depth and complexity of "Covenant" by Soen, I’ve been drawn into a world of contemplation and introspection. The song has forced me to confront the darker corners of my own psyche, to question my own assumptions and doubts, and to seek answers to the timeless questions that have haunted humanity for centuries. "What lies within?" the song seems to whisper, its haunting melody weaving a sonic tapestry that will stay with me long after the music fades away.
In the end, the true meaning of "Covenant" by Soen lies not in its clever wordplay or intricate music, but in its searingly honest portrayal of the human condition. "Life is a mirror, face the truth", the song seems to command, as it urges us to gaze into the reflective surface of our own hearts, to confront the good and the bad, and to find the strength to rise above the shadows.
